Transaction 8faf6361f1b38402c148dc61c5e9070e51e7128bbebf7becc06f7d43514ef78e
1 Input
1 Output
-
8faf6361f1b38402c148dc61c5e9070e51e7128bbebf7becc06f7d43514ef78e:0
- value
- 30736
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ebc9d2c27e167b27f3db28e7d7b71c2f76f7118e
- address
- bc1qa0ya9sn7zeaj0u7m9rna0dcu9am0wyvwslmwu9